Keemun (or qi men) is a Chinese black tea that is robust and hearty, yet bright enough not to overwhelm. A subtle sweetness is revealed when paired with peppermint, further complemented by spearmint, crushed roasted cacao beans and blue cornflower.

A small ode to Manderley’s favorite childhood ice cream flavor.

Serving Suggestion: start with 3-4 grams or 1 teaspoon in 8-10 ounces of water at 212 degrees Fahrenheit (boiling) then steep for 3-4 minutes.
